WPS如何一键把Word批注批量导出为独立Excel清单?

为什么“批注导出”突然成了刚需?
在多人协作的标书、教材、法律合同里,批注往往比正文更值钱。过去只能靠“Ctrl+C 逐条复制”或截图存档,一旦条目过百,漏掉关键修改就是事故。把批注转成 Excel 清单,既能按“作者+日期”透视,也能用筛选快速定位高风险条款,是运营、法务、教务三线共同的“硬需求”。
功能定位:WPS 原生方案与边界
截至当前的最新版本,WPS Writer 在 Windows/macOS 客户端均内置“批注导出”命令,无需插件。它一次性提取当前文档内所有批注的“编号、作者、日期、批注内容、被批注文本”五字段,生成 .xlsx 文件;但不提取已解决批注的“解决理由”,也不包含批注框的格式(颜色、字号)。
与“修订记录”区别
修订记录(Track Changes)反映的是“增删改”动作,适合回溯过程;批注是“评论”动作,适合留痕疑问。两者数据结构不同,导出命令各自独立,不可混用。
一键导出:最短路径(含平台差异)
Windows 桌面端
- 打开含批注的 .docx 或 .wps 文件。
- 顶部菜单审阅→批注组→点击导出批注。
- 在弹窗勾选“包含被批注文本”“按页码分组”(默认全选)。
- 选择保存位置与文件名→保存。
- 完成后自动打开 Excel,可立即透视或筛选。
示例:若合同共 127 条批注,导出耗时约 5 秒,生成的表格可直接插入数据透视,按“作者”统计人均修改量。
macOS 桌面端
入口相同,但步骤 2 的按钮位于Review→Comments→Export Comments;若系统语言为简体中文,菜单会自动汉化。经验性观察:macOS 版在 300 条以上批注时进度条可能出现“假死”,静置数十秒即可,勿强制退出。
Android / iOS / 云文档网页端
移动端暂不提供原生导出按钮;工作假设:可先转存为云文档,用“电脑打开”按钮在本地客户端完成导出,再回传手机。若设备只有手机,可借助“分享→发送为 PDF+批注”,然后用第三方表格工具手动誊录,但已不属于一键方案。
字段解析与清洗建议
导出后的 Excel 默认包含五列:编号、作者、日期、批注内容、被批注文本。日期列为“yyyy-mm-dd hh:mm”格式,可直接用透视表按周汇总;作者列若出现邮箱后缀,可用“文本到列”清除域名,方便后续合并同名账号。
提示
若批注内含手动换行(Alt+Enter),Excel 会保留换行符,筛选时可能看似“空白”。可在数据→文本到列→分隔符号→其他:输入 CHAR(10) 清除。
常见失败分支与回退方案
| 现象 | 可能原因 | 验证与处置 |
|---|---|---|
| 导出按钮灰色 | 文档受保护或处于“只读”模式 | 审阅→限制编辑→停止保护;若提示密码,需联系原作者。 |
| 仅导出部分批注 | 文档含“隐藏文字”或批注位于页眉页脚 | 文件→选项→显示→勾选“隐藏文字”,再执行导出。 |
| Excel 打开乱码 | 系统区域格式为英文,未识别中文双引号 | Excel→数据→自文本→选择 65001: UTF-8 重新导入。 |
什么时候不该用“一键导出”?
- 需要连同“解决状态”“答复内容”一起归档——原生命令不包含,只能手动补录。
- 批注内嵌截图或形状——导出后仅保留文字,图像会丢失。
- 文档已启用“限制访问”IRM 且导出按钮被组织策略禁用——需向 IT 申请临时权限。
警告
若文件需对外披露,导出前请用“文档检查器”删除隐藏属性与作者账号,避免泄露内部邮箱。
与第三方协同:API 与脚本的可行性
WPS 暂未开放文档批注粒度的官方 API;经验性观察,可通过 Python-win32com 调用 Windows 版 COM 接口遍历 Comments 集合,但需本地安装桌面客户端,且 macOS 无 COM 环境。若企业需自动化,可评估“导出批注+Python 清洗”两段式:先人工点击导出,再用脚本自动合并到 BI 系统,成本低于全自动化。
适用场景清单(决策速查)
| 场景 | 批注量级 | 是否推荐 |
|---|---|---|
| 月度合同会签 | 50-200 条 | ✅ 一键导出即可 |
| 教材三审三校 | 500-1000 条 | ✅ 导出后需透视+人工复核 |
| 审计底稿长期归档 | 需保留“解决理由” | ❌ 原生导出不足,需二次补录 |
最佳实践 5 条(可打印检查表)
- 导出前统一作者昵称:文件→选项→用户信息,避免同一人的中英文双名。
- 按“日期-作者”双关键字排序,可快速发现“隔夜未回复”批注。
- 给被批注文本加前后 10 字摘要,防止原文被修改后失去对照。
- 建立“已导出”标记列,用 VLOOKUP 比对下次新增批注,实现增量更新。
- 对外发送前,用 Excel 的“删除属性”功能清除作者账号,满足合规。
故障排查 FAQ(Schema 版)
导出后日期列变成 5 位数字怎么办?
Excel 把日期当序列号存储,选中列→右键“设置单元格格式”→日期→选择 yyyy-mm-dd 即可恢复。
能否只导出某几页的批注?
原生命令不支持范围筛选;可先复制目标页到新文档再导出,或导出后用“页码”列筛选后删除无关行。
批注内容含隐私,如何彻底清空?
使用“文档检查器”→批注→全部删除,再保存;此操作不可逆,建议先另存副本。
版本差异与迁移建议
2025 及更早版本无原生按钮,需借助“另存为 XML+Excel Power Query”迂回;若组织内仍有旧版,建议优先升级到 12.8.4 以上,避免维护两套流程。信创环境请使用官网提供的鲲鹏/龙腾专用安装包,功能与 x86 版一致。
验证与观测方法
为确认导出完整性,可事前在文档插入 10 条测试批注(含换行、英文、表情),执行导出后用 COUNTA 函数核对行数;若差值≠0,按上文“隐藏文字”步骤排查。经验性观察:批注>1000 条时,文件大小每增加 1 MB,导出耗时约增加数秒,可据此预估等待时间。
未来趋势与版本预期
从官方更新日志看,WPS 在 12.8.x 系列中持续优化大文档性能,预计下一版本将支持“解决状态”字段导出,并开放批注范围筛选。若你所在团队已把批注清单接入 Power BI,可提前在 Excel 模板预留“解决理由”空列,待新版本落地即可直接映射,无需二次改造。
收尾:下一步行动
批注导出不是终点,而是评审流程数字化的起点。今天先花 3 分钟把正在修订的合同导出成 Excel,顺手建一个透视表,看看哪位同事的高风险修改被遗漏;然后给团队立两条规矩——“批注必须带日期+页码”“导出后 24 小时内回复”,就能把隐形成本压到最低。WPS 已经提供了官方原生按钮,剩下的只是你把流程跑通。